What is Magnesium Glycinate?
Magnesium glycinate is a compound that combines magnesium with glycine, an amino acid. This form of magnesium is known for its high bioavailability, which means that it is easily absorbed by the body. This makes it an excellent option for those looking to increase their magnesium levels without experiencing the gastrointestinal discomfort often associated with other forms of magnesium supplements.
Health Benefits of Magnesium Glycinate
1. Supports Muscle Function: Magnesium plays a crucial role in muscle contraction and relaxation. Supplementing with magnesium glycinate can help reduce muscle cramps and improve overall muscle function.
2. Promotes Relaxation and Sleep: Magnesium is known for its calming effects on the nervous system. Magnesium glycinate can help improve sleep quality and reduce anxiety, making it a popular choice for those struggling with insomnia or stress.
3. Enhances Bone Health: Magnesium is vital for bone formation and health. Adequate magnesium levels can help prevent osteoporosis and support overall skeletal strength.
4. Aids in Blood Sugar Control: Some studies suggest that magnesium may help regulate blood sugar levels, making magnesium glycinate a beneficial supplement for those with insulin sensitivity or diabetes.
5. Supports Heart Health: Magnesium is important for maintaining a healthy heart rhythm and can help lower blood pressure. Regular supplementation may contribute to cardiovascular health.

Magnesium Glycinate Kaina (Price)
When it comes to pricing, magnesium glycinate can vary based on several factors, including brand, formulation, and quantity. On average, you can expect to pay anywhere from $10 to $30 for a month’s supply. Here’s a general breakdown of what to look for:
– Quality Brands: Well-known brands may charge a premium for their products due to rigorous testing and quality assurance.
– Formulation: Magnesium glycinate may come in various forms, including capsules, powders, or gummies, which can influence the price.
– Bulk Purchases: Buying in bulk or larger quantities often results in cost savings.
